Part 1: How to React to a TikTok Video
After being equipped with all the worldly knowledge about TikTok reaction videos, you can follow the steps given below to learn how to react to the footage created by other people:
1. Tap Share and Record Your Reaction
Start TikTok, play the video you want to react on, tap the Share icon from the lower-right area, and tap the React option from the Share to menu. Tap Flip from the top-right corner of the Camera screen to switch between the front and rear camera as needed, optionally tap the Mic icon to disable or enable voice and system audio capture, drag and reposition React window according to the source footage, and tap the Record button from the bottom to start shooting your TikTok reaction. Wait while the source clip and your recording process are complete successfully before moving forward to the next step.
2. Apply Filters
Tap the Filters icon from the top-right corner, tap to pick a filter from those available at the bottom, and tap anywhere on the screen to accept the one you selected and to get back to the previous window.
3. Manage Audio
Tap the Mixer icon from the upper-right corner of the screen, drag the My Voice and Soundtrack Volume sliders to manage your voice recording and the internal audio respectively, and tap Done to save the changes once you’re through with the modifications. Back on the previous window, tap Next from the bottom-right corner.
4. Publish the Video
Tap the Who can view this video option to manage your reaction’s visibility settings (optional). Tap the Save to device toggle switch to prevent TikTok reaction from being stored on your mobile’s storage (optional). Next, tap the Post button from the bottom-right corner to publish the video to TikTok.

Part 1: How to Speed up a Video on TikTok While Recording? (Using Android Phone)
The easiest and fastest way to speed up a video is while recording. The TikTok speed feature on your android phone will allow you to choose 2X or 3X speed.
Step 1: Launch the TikTok app on your android phone and tap on the [+] button at the bottom center of the screen.
Step 2: To speed up a video on TikTok while recording, choose either the 2X or 3X speed options by just clicking on the speed icons.
Step 3: Click the red button at the bottom center of the screen to start recording your video at a faster speed. Add any other video effect you desire and post the video.
Part 2: How to Speed Up a Video on TikTok While Uploading
This method applies to already prerecorded and saved videos on the TikTok app.
Step 1: Tap on the TikTok app icon on your android phone and click on the [+] button with Post written below it.
Step 2: Choose any of the high-speed options (2X and 3X) by tapping on the number.
Step 3: Click on the Upload button located to the bottom right-hand side of the screen. A new page with Videos and Photos will pop up. Select the video you want to speed up on TikTok while uploading from the gallery.
Step 4: Tap on the red arrow pointing to the right at the bottom right, describe your video, and click Post.
Part 3: How to Speed Up the Playback Speed on TikTok [2 Ways]
Speeding up the playback speed on TikTok entails changing the speed of an already created and posted video to play 2 times or 3 times the normal speed. This is similar to speeding up the playback speed on YouTube.
Method 1: Speed Up Video Playback on TikTok Mobile
Step 1: Open the TikTok app on your iPhone and Android phone, and then switch to the video that you want to play faster.
Step 2: Press and hold the video for about 2 seconds, and then you will see some options such as Favorite, Not Interested, Duet, and Speed.
Step 3: Click the speed icon, and then select 1.5X or 2X to speed up the video when watching.
Method 2: Speed Up TikTok Video Playback on Computer
Step 1: Open the TikTok app on your Windows computer, move the cursor to your profile picture, and select View Profile.
Step 2: Choose the video you want to speed up the playback speed on TikTok.
Step 3: Using the right button on your mouse, right-click on the video and choose Show All Controls on the pop-up window.
Step 4: Click on the three vertical buttons located at the bottom right and select Playback speed. If you’re operating on Windows 11, the speed options that will speed up your playback speed are 1.25X, 1.5 X, 1.75X, and 2 X.
You can now watch your TikTok video at a faster playback speed.
